Crisis Negotiation Team




The Rowlett Police Department formed a Crisis Negotiation Team (CNT) within the department in early 1998. It is comprised of department members from all three divisions including Support Services.  All  team members meet the state requirements to perform the duties of hostage negotiation and attend advanced training schools annually to stay current. All are also members of the Texas Association of Hostage Negotiators.





CNT Team members respond to critical incidents such as hostage situations, barricaded persons, suicidal subjects, and any other situation in which the introduction of a negotiator would lead to the peaceful resolution of an incident. Since both CNT and the SWAT Team's goals are so closely intertwined- the successful resolution of a Crisis situation by peaceful means, the two units train together regularly. During these scenarios, role players take the parts of hostages and suspects to add realism to the training.
